Understanding Toner Cartridges and How Do They Work


These cartridges are specifically designed units used in laser printers and photocopiers. They house a refined powder known as toner, which is made up of plastic particles, carbon, and colouring agents. When printing takes place, the toner is transferred onto paper using an electrical charge system and then fused using heat to form a lasting print.

This technology allows laser printers to deliver sharp text and detailed graphics at speed. Compared to ink-based printing, toner cartridges offer enhanced durability and performance, making them a preferred choice for settings with heavy printing demands.

Advantages of Using Toner Cartridges


A major benefit of using toner cartridges is their ability to produce high-quality prints with sharp detail and clarity. They are therefore ideal for professional documents, reports, presentations, and marketing materials.

An additional advantage is long-term cost effectiveness. Although toner cartridges may have a higher upfront cost compared to ink cartridges, they typically last longer and yield a higher page count. This results in a lower cost per page, which is highly advantageous for organisations with frequent printing needs.

Speed is another important advantage. Laser printers using toner cartridges are known for their fast printing capabilities, enabling users to handle large workloads without delays. Moreover, toner remains stable unlike ink, which ensures reliable output even after long idle durations.

Different Types of Toner Cartridges


There are multiple types of toner cartridges offered today, each tailored for specific requirements. Regular cartridges work well for routine printing, providing consistent output at an economical cost.

High-capacity cartridges are ideal for heavy users. These cartridges hold a larger amount of toner and can deliver a greater page yield, making them ideal for offices and businesses aiming to reduce replacement frequency.

Remanufactured and compatible cartridges are also commonly chosen options. These alternatives are usually budget-friendly and eco-conscious, as they involve reusing and refurbishing existing cartridge components while maintaining quality standards.

Selecting the appropriate option depends on usage levels, budget constraints, and quality expectations. Being aware of these choices enables better decisions that align with their specific needs.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Toner Cartridges


Choosing suitable toner cartridges demands thoughtful evaluation of several factors. Compatibility with your printer is crucial, as each printer model is designed to work with specific cartridge types. Using incompatible cartridges can lead to poor performance or even damage the printer.

Page yield is equally important. It refers to the number of pages a cartridge can produce before required replacement. For high-volume users, choosing high-capacity options can significantly reduce operational costs.

Consistent quality and dependability are essential. High-quality toner cartridges deliver stable output without smudging, fading, or streaking. Users toner cartridges should look for cartridges that meet industry standards and offer long-term reliability.

Environmental impact is becoming increasingly important. Many users are choosing greener alternatives such as remanufactured cartridges, which help reduce waste and support sustainable practices.

How to Maintain Toner Cartridges Effectively


Proper maintenance is essential to get the best performance from toner cartridges. Keeping cartridges in a dry, cool environment preserves their condition and prevents clumping or degradation of toner powder.

Regular printer maintenance also plays a key role. Maintaining internal parts and checking alignment can enhance output and extend the lifespan of the cartridge.

Users should also avoid unnecessary printing and use print settings wisely. Draft mode can be used for non-essential prints, while premium settings should be used for critical documents. This strategy conserves toner and lowers expenses.

Replacing cartridges at the right time is equally important. Waiting too long can lead to reduced print quality and potential damage to the printer. Monitoring print output and replacing cartridges when needed ensures smooth and uninterrupted operation.

Common Issues and How to Resolve Them


While toner cartridges are generally reliable, users may occasionally encounter issues such as faded prints, streaks, or uneven output. These problems are commonly due to low toner levels, improper installation, or dirty printer components.

To fix these problems, users should begin by checking toner levels and install a new cartridge if required. Reinstalling the cartridge correctly can also eliminate alignment problems. Cleaning the printer drum and other internal parts can improve output quality.

A frequent concern is the appearance of lines or spots on printed pages. This can be addressed by cleaning the printer or replacing worn-out components. Regular maintenance and proper handling can minimise such issues.
